摘 要:四川前陆盆地由于构造相对复杂,探讨不同构造带上成岩作用和成岩相差异对储层预测具有重要意义。在沉积相、铸体薄片观察和岩矿分析数据基础上,对各构造带上须家河组砂岩的成岩作用进行系统研究。得出逆冲推覆带前缘以压实作用和破裂作用为主;川西前渊坳陷带以压实和压溶作用为主;前陆斜坡和前陆隆起带压实作用相对较弱,绿泥石环边胶结作用和溶蚀作用发育,其中起破坏作用的成岩作用主要有压实-压溶作用、胶结作用,起建设性的成岩作用主要有早期绿泥石环边胶结作用、溶蚀作用和破裂作用。在成岩作用研究的基础上,进行了成岩相划分及成岩相组合特征分析,将须家河组砂岩划分为3种成岩相组合,其中压实-破裂-胶结成岩相和胶结-溶蚀成岩相为最有利于储层发育的成岩相带。The structure in the Sichuan foreland basin is complicated,so the research on the differences of diagenesis and diagenetic facies in different tectonic zones is very significant to the reservoir prediction.Based on the analyses of sedimentary facies,cast thin slices,rock and mineral logging data,diagenesis of the sandstones in different tectonic zones of Xujiahe Formation have been researched systematically.The conclusion shows that in the thrusting nappe tectonic zone,there are mainly compaction and cataclasis.In the western depression,there are mainly compaction and pressolution,while in the ramp region and the uplift zone,the compaction is relatively weak and the rim agglutination of chlorite the compaction and denudation are relatively develop.The destructive diagenesis is mainly the compaction-pressure solution and cementation.The constructive diagenesis is mainly the rim agglutination of chlorite,denudation and cataclasis.Based on the research of diagenesis,the diagenetic facies is divided,and the diagenetic facies association of Xujiahe Formation sandstone is divided into three types,the diagenetic facies which is beneficial to the reservoir development are compaction-clastation-cementation and cementation-denudation types.
